A Ford Escape engine cannot run without a key due to the vehicle’s ignition system design. The key is essential for both starting the engine and activating the fuel and electrical systems necessary for operation.
Ford Escape Ignition System Functionality
The ignition system in a Ford Escape is designed to prevent unauthorized access and operation of the vehicle. The key contains a transponder chip that communicates with the vehicle’s computer, ensuring that only the correct key can start the engine. Without this key, the engine will not run, as the system is built to disable fuel delivery and ignition timing.

If your Ford Escape is having trouble starting, follow these steps to troubleshoot the issue effectively.
-
Check the Battery: Ensure the battery is fully charged and connections are clean.
-
Inspect the Key: Look for damage or wear on the transponder key.
-
Test the Ignition Switch: Use a multimeter to check for continuity.
-
Scan for Error Codes: Use an OBD-II scanner to identify any fault codes.

Understanding the potential costs involved in ignition repairs can help you budget accordingly. Here’s a breakdown of common expenses.
| Service | Estimated Cost |
|---|---|
| Key Replacement | $150 – $300 |
| Ignition Switch Repair | $100 – $250 |
| Anti-Theft System Reset | $50 – $150 |
| Battery Replacement | $75 – $200 |
